In recent years, Western Drilling Company often encountered that the borehole is proneto collapse, and other complex issues happen all the time in Tuha oilfield. During the drillingprocess, these phenomenons are commonly meet, such as trip blocking, sticking, drilling pipebreaking, even without well completion, which causing great economic losses. In the light ofshale wellbore instability in Tuha oilfield, this paper has researched the mechanism of claylayer borehole instability by co-utilizing all the methods of X-ray diffraction, SEM, hydrateexpansion and dispersion and specific water wettability, et al. It proposed the effectively plug,reasonable density to support, lay stress on inhibiting surface hydration multiple elementscooperation anti-collapse technical strategy, and further more, probed into the mechanism of it.At last, a high effective cooperation anti-collapse drillingfluid formula has been developed,which achieved good feedbacks in field applications.Experimental studies have shown that the shale in Tuha oilfield region has the followingdistinguishing features such as mineral cemented, bedding, micro-fissures, hydration andstrong dispersion, low thermal expansion and low CEC and other characteristics, but itssurface hydration ability and local hydration cause borehole instability easily.Based on the basic principles of the "synergistic diversifications" for anti-collapse ofdrilling fluid, Many treatment agents are selected, such as a strong inhibition of polyamineagent SDJA, agent CMC-HV. Preferred in molecular polymer fluid loss additive PJA-2, resinfiltration reducer loss agent SHR-1, lignite class Filtrate Reducer CXB-1, the lubricantJXFQ-2are optimized. And high performance anti-collapse drilling fluid formula isconstructed according to the multiple elements cooperation anti-collapse theory. Theanti-collapse drilling fluid formula posses good performances,such as sealing,inhibition,rheology behavior, lubricity, heat resistance, et al. The properties are better than the presenton-site drilling fluid formula. The anti-collapse drilling fluid with good resistance to weightup, salt, poor soil possesses good performances,such as sealing, inhibition and rheology behavior.According to results on-site in well Guo802of Tuha oilfield, it has manyperformances,such as good lubricity, good stability in high temperature, and it is easy tomaintain. This shows that the newly develop ed anti-collapse drilling fluid has stronganti-collapse capability, and meets the construction requirments of shale in Tuha oilfiled.
